Grenoble-Ritter

Julie Lynn Grenoble, of Muncy, and Jed Thomas Ritter, of Hughesville, were united in marriage at 1:30 p.m. Saturday, June 15, 2013.

The Rev. Dr. Donald P. Edwards officiated at the ceremony held in Muncy.

A rehearsal dinner was held in Hughesville and a reception was held in Williamsport.

The bride is the daughter of Kathy and Nathan Grenoble, of Muncy. She graduated from Muncy High School in 2004 and received a bachelor’s degree in history from Lycoming College in 2008. She is employed by Montoursville Area School District as a high school librarian.

Ritter is the son of Joni and Wayne Ritter, of Hughesville. He graduated from Hughesville High School in 2007. He received a bachelor’s degree in life science from Penn State University, State College, in 2011, and is attending Penn State College of Medicine, Hershey.

Matron of honor was Elizabeth Verazin, of Nanticoke, cousin of the bride.

Bridesmaids were Casey Snook, of Mifflinburg; Tara Grenoble, of Watsontown, sister-in-law of the bride; Ashley Elser, of Muncy; Ashley Long, of Montgomery; and Kelsey and Juniel Ritter, of Hughesville, and sisters of the bridegroom. Flowergirl was Haley Verazin, of Nanticoke, second cousin of the bride.

Ringbearer was Joshua Grenoble, of Watsontown, nephew of the bride.

Best man was Chet Ritter, of Hughesville, brother of the bridegroom.

Groomsmen were Corey Heller, of Muncy; Justin Grenoble, of Watsontown, brother of the bride; Mike Schmitt and Kyle Murren, both of Hughesville; John Ritter, of Hughesville, brother of the bridegroom; and Kyle Johnson, of Muncy.

The couple is residing in Turbotville.
